Background
With the rapid development of electronic commerce, online shopping transactions are more and more common, so that logistics distribution business can be rapidly developed. At present, express delivery in the express delivery industry generally has three modes of self-service delivery of an intelligent express cabinet, delivery of a post station and delivery of a courier at home, wherein the delivery of the post station is the most common delivery mode. After the express mail arrives at the post station, the post station prints express mail serial numbers according to the freight bill numbers of the express mail, then the express mail serial numbers are pasted on the express mail, and the express mail serial numbers are sent to a pickup person through short messages; when the pickup person gets the express, the person who goes out of the warehouse searches the express on the goods shelf according to the express serial number provided by the pickup person, and after the express is found, the pickup person takes away the express, or the pickup person searches the express by himself and then directly takes away the express.
The dispatch mode of taking the dispatch through the stager often has the following disadvantages: if the express delivery personnel search for the express delivery, special delivery personnel need to be arranged, and the labor cost is high; if the person who takes the express mail finds the express mail by himself and goes out of the warehouse, the risk of losing the express mail is higher.

Fig. 1 is a schematic view of a partial structure of a pickup person for picking up a package through a express receiving and dispatching station provided in this embodiment from a first viewing angle; fig. 2 is a schematic structural diagram of a pickup person picking up a package through the express receiving and dispatching station provided in this embodiment from a second perspective; fig. 3 is a schematic structural diagram of a pickup person picking up a package through the express receiving and dispatching station provided in this embodiment from a third perspective. As shown in fig. 1 to fig. 3, the present embodiment provides an express receiving and dispatching station, and specifically, the express receiving and dispatching station includes a shelf 020, an entrance guard 030 and an express delivery warehouse all-in-one machine 010, wherein the shelf 020 is used for storing express 050 provided with express information, the entrance guard 030 is provided with a detection device and an alarm, the detection device is used for detecting whether anti-theft information on the express 050 has been eliminated, and the alarm is used for giving an alarm when the detection device detects the anti-theft information.
When the person who gets the express mail through this express mail receiving and dispatching station gets the express mail, can take off own express mail 050 from goods shelves 020 to place in express mail ex-warehouse all-in-one 010 department, accomplish the scanning of express mail serial number by express mail ex-warehouse all-in-one 010 and handle to taking a picture of person, realize the record to person's identity of getting a mail. When the pickup person is ready to leave, if the detection device detects that the anti-theft information on the express 050 is not eliminated, the alarm gives an alarm to prompt that the express 050 has a risk of losing the express; if the detection device detects that the anti-theft information on the express mail 050 has been eliminated, the person taking the express mail can directly carry the express mail 050 out of the express mail receiving and dispatching station.
The goods shelf 020 is arranged in the express receiving and dispatching station, so that the express 050 can be stored, and the neatness of the interior of the express receiving and dispatching station is improved. Moreover, by arranging the express delivery ex-warehouse all-in-one machine 010, self-service delivery taking is realized, the labor cost of the traditional post station delivery taking process is reduced, and meanwhile, the express delivery ex-warehouse all-in-one machine 010 can also collect delivery person information in the delivery taking process, so that the risk of delivery loss in the traditional post station delivery taking process is reduced. In addition, due to the arrangement of the entrance guard 030, alarm processing can be timely carried out on suspicious piece taking operation, and the risk of losing pieces is further reduced.
Specifically, the express information can comprise express numbers and anti-theft information. The anti-theft information on the express piece 050 can be magnetic information or radio frequency information, and when the anti-theft information on the express piece 050 is the magnetic information, the detection device can detect the anti-theft information on the express piece 050 by using an electromagnetic wave detection technology; when the anti-theft information on the express 050 is the radio frequency information, the detection device can detect the anti-theft information of the express 050 by using a radio frequency detection technology.

As shown in fig. 4, the embodiment further provides an express delivery and warehouse exit all-in-one machine 010, where the express delivery and warehouse exit all-in-one machine 010 includes a rack 100, a scanner 200, and a camera 300, and specifically, both the scanner 200 and the camera 300 are disposed in the rack 100, where the scanner 200 is used to scan express numbers on the express delivery 050, and the camera 300 is used to take pictures of a person taking a delivery.
The process that the pickup person picks up the express mail through the express mail warehouse-out all-in-one machine 010 is as follows: the person taking the express mail puts the express mail 050 to be taken away at the scanner 200, the scanner 200 scans express mail numbers on the express mail 050, and the camera 300 takes a picture of the person taking the express mail to acquire information.
This express mail all-in-one 010 has realized getting the piece by oneself, has reduced the human cost that traditional post house got a piece in-process staff, moreover, can also utilize camera 300 to gather the information of getting the person, has reduced traditional post house to a certain extent and has got a loss risk that the in-process exists.
Referring to fig. 4, in the present embodiment, the rack 100 may include a base 110 and a supporting frame 120, where the base 110 is used to support the express item 050, the supporting frame 120 is fixedly connected to the base 110, and the scanner 200 and the camera 300 are both disposed on the supporting frame 120.
Due to the arrangement, the express delivery warehouse-out all-in-one machine 010 can be stably placed on the operation table 060, and the shaking of the express delivery warehouse-out all-in-one machine in the use process is reduced. Meanwhile, the express mail 050 is supported by the base 110, so that a person taking out the express mail 050 can be placed on the base 110 for scanning, arm ache caused by the fact that the person taking out the express mail 050 is lifted for a long time is avoided, and the experience of taking out the express mail is improved.
The express delivery warehouse-out all-in-one machine 010 can further comprise an anti-theft information eliminating device (not shown in the figure), specifically, the anti-theft information eliminating device is arranged on the base 110 and used for eliminating anti-theft information on the express delivery 050.
If the pickup person picks up the express mail according to the pickup requirement, when the pickup person places the express mail 050 on the base, the anti-theft information eliminating device can eliminate the anti-theft information on the express mail 050; if the pickup person does not pick up the express item according to the express item taking requirement (such as refusing to take a picture without matching with the camera 300), the anti-theft information on the express item 050 can exist all the time, and when the pickup person carries the express item 050 with the anti-theft information to pass through the entrance guard 030, the detection device detects the anti-theft information on the express item 050, so that the alarm gives an alarm prompt.
Specifically, the antitheft information eliminating device may include a demagnetization module, and at this time, the antitheft information eliminating device may perform antitheft information eliminating processing on express mail 050 using magnetic information as antitheft information. Of course, the anti-theft information eliminating device may further include a radio frequency read-write module, and at this time, the anti-theft information eliminating device may perform anti-theft information eliminating processing on express mail 050 using radio frequency information as anti-theft information.
It should be noted that, in this embodiment, when the anti-theft information on the express piece 050 is magnetic information, the eliminating device may be a magnet or an energizing coil, and as long as a magnetic field generated by the eliminating device is greater than a coercive force of the magnetic information on the anti-theft magnetic stripe, a magnetization direction on the anti-theft magnetic stripe may be changed, so as to achieve the purpose of demagnetization.
Specifically, in this embodiment, the express delivery warehouse-out all-in-one machine 010 may further include a weight sensor (not shown in the figure), where the weight sensor is disposed on the base 110 and is configured to detect whether the express delivery 050 is disposed on the base 110.
When the person of picking up the express mail 050 is placed in base 110, the weight sensor senses that express mail 050 exists on base 110 at this moment, and then scanner 200 and camera 300 begin to work, scan express mail serial number and take a picture to the person of picking up the express mail.
Preferably, in this embodiment, the express delivery and warehouse exit all-in-one machine 010 may further include a controller (not shown in the figure), wherein the weight sensor, the scanner 200, and the camera 300 are all electrically connected to the controller. According to the arrangement, when the weight sensor detects that the express mail 050 is placed on the base 110, the weight sensor outputs a detection signal to the controller, and the controller controls the scanner 200 and the camera 300 to work, so that the express mail warehouse-out all-in-one machine 010 can be automatically started according to the express mail taking requirement of a express mail taker, and the automation degree is high.

Referring to fig. 4, in the present embodiment, the supporting frame 120 may include a vertical column 121 and a cross beam 122, specifically, the bottom end of the vertical column 121 is fixedly connected to the base 110, and the cross beam 122 is fixedly connected to the top end of the vertical column 121. Wherein, the scanner 200 is disposed on the beam 122, and the scanner 200 is opposite to the base 110; the camera 300 is disposed on the pillar 121.
Through setting up scanner 200 to be relative with base 110 for express mail 050 is after being placed in base 110, scanner 200 is relative with express mail 050, can directly scan express mail serial number, need not to carry out repeated adjustment to express mail 050's position, thereby has improved and has got a efficiency. Moreover, the camera 300 is arranged on the upright post 121 between the base 110 and the cross beam 122, so that the area of the area which can be collected by the camera 300 is increased, the photographing requirements of people with different heights can be met, and the adaptability of the express delivery warehouse-out all-in-one machine 010 is improved.
Preferably, in the present embodiment, the beam 122 is opposite to the base 110, and the scanner 200 is disposed in the middle of the beam 122.
The express delivery warehouse-out all-in-one machine 010 can further comprise an identity information extraction device, and specifically, the identity information extraction device is arranged on the rack 100 and used for extracting the identity information of a delivery person.
Before the taker leaves the express receiving and dispatching station, the identity information of the taker can be extracted and backed up by using the identity information extraction device. When a lost article occurs and the camera 300 shoots and cannot obtain the related information of the lawbreaker, the identity information of the article taker collected by the identity information extraction device can be compared with the database information of the related department to judge the real identity of the lawbreaker.
Specifically, the identity information extraction means may include at least one of an identity card recognition module, a fingerprint recognition module, an iris recognition module, a palm vein recognition module, and a finger vein recognition module.
